Floor leveling is a crucial process in ensuring a smooth, even surface for flooring installation. Properly leveled floors contribute to the longevity and performance of various floor coverings, including hardwood, tile, and carpet. Accurate leveling can prevent issues such as uneven wear, cracking, and shifting over time, making it a vital step in construction and renovation projects.

The process of floor leveling typically involves assessing the existing surface, preparing the area, and applying leveling compounds or materials to fill in low spots and create a uniform plane. This process can vary in duration depending on the size and condition of the space, but generally, a professional can complete standard projects within a few hours to a day. Proper preparation and application are essential to ensure the durability and stability of the finished floor.
